Today On TV
Hideous Houses
Eric, Kurt and Megan have some serious work to do in Cypress, Calif. While Megan is busy trying to solve a design dilemma, rain causes trouble for Eric and Kurt as they work on a grilling deck. They have just four days and $20,000 to get the job done. A&E, 9 a.m.
20/20 on TLC
Four back-to-back new episodes recount true crime tales in this mini-marathon. This debut tells the story of 15-year-old Leah Freeman. Her body was found six weeks after she was reported missing. Later, learn how a dream honeymoon ended in tragedy. TLC, 6 p.m.
Law & Order: Special Victims Unit
When a Romani child disappears on the way home from school, Stabler and Benson face resistance from a community that doesn't trust the police. This rebroadcast features special guest appearances from Gilbert Gottfried, Ron Rifkin and Gavin Lee. NBC, 9 p.m.
Grimm's Snow White
Eliza Bennett, Jane March and Jamie Thomas King star in this new adaptation of the timeless fairy tale. After giant reptiles devour the king, a courageous Snow White escapes to the enchanted forest. Meanwhile, the Queen plots to take over the kingdom. Space. 9 p.m.
